Hi,

As my cubietruck went down because of a kernel bug in stretch i tought
it was maybe better to upgrade to buster since that's around the corner.
However now wifi stopped working:

[   16.871534] brcmfmac: brcmf_sdio_bus_rxctl: resumed on timeout
[   16.877576] brcmfmac: brcmf_bus_started: failed: -110
[   16.928040] brcmfmac: brcmf_attach: dongle is not responding:
err=-110
[   16.972120] brcmfmac: brcmf_sdio_firmware_callback: brcmf_attach
failed

A powercycle doesn't help in my case. Reports of similar issues mention
a firmware problem. This is what's currently installed on it:

ii  firmware-brcm80211              20190114-1                   all
Binary firmware for Broadcom/Cypress 802.11 wireless cards

ii  linux-image-4.19.0-2-armmp-lpae 4.19.16-1                    armhf
Linux 4.19 for ARMv7 multiplatform compatible SoCs supporting LPAE
